WebPolyp (Cnidarian) Like all cnidarian polyps, hydra has two cell layers (Fig. 1B) and displays a tube shape with a single opening circled by a ring of tentacles, which has a mouth–anus function, whereas the basal disk secretes mucous to attach to the substratum (Fig. 1C). WebThe polyps constituting the colony may be widely separated from each other with separate theca or the thecae of the different polyps may fuse together to form a common wall. The polyps are usually small, varying from 1 mm to 3 cm in length. The space between the thecae of coral colonies is occupied in living state by coenenchyme. WebPolyps are classified by their morphologic features; either pedunculated or sessile. Pedunculated polyps have a head attached by a stalk to the mucosa of the colon or rectum.
